Comparing Fields

Comparing Fields
Source: images.unsplash.com

Introduction

The Multi Field formula in Alteryx allows users to compare columns after joining them together. This formula is particularly useful when there is a need to compare multiple columns simultaneously. By utilizing the Multi Field formula, users can easily perform conditional formatting for data analysis and visualization.

Explanation of comparing fields in conditional formatting

When comparing fields in conditional formatting, the Multi Field formula evaluates the values in the specified columns and provides a result based on the given conditions. This formula can be used to create complex logic and perform calculations that involve multiple fields.

The Multi Field formula supports various mathematical and logical operations, including addition, subtraction, multiplication, division, comparison operators (such as greater than, less than), and conditional statements (such as IF-THEN-ELSE). Users can customize the formula to suit their specific needs and effectively analyze their data.

Examples of scenarios where comparing fields can be useful

1. Identifying data discrepancies:

– By comparing two columns, users can easily identify any discrepancies or inconsistencies in the data. This is particularly useful when dealing with large datasets or conducting data quality checks.

2. Highlighting outliers:

– Comparing multiple columns can help identify outliers or anomalies in the data. For example, users can compare actual sales values with predicted sales values to identify any significant deviations.

3. Investigating trends:

– By comparing fields over time, users can uncover patterns or trends in the data. This can be helpful in identifying seasonality, growth rates, or any other time-dependent changes.

4. Conditional formatting based on thresholds:

– Users can compare fields against predefined thresholds to apply conditional formatting. For example, if a sales value is below a certain threshold, it can be highlighted in red to indicate underperformance.

5. Calculating performance metrics:

– By comparing different fields, users can calculate performance metrics such as percentage change, average differences, or ratios. This can provide valuable insights for decision-making and performance evaluation.

In summary, the Multi Field formula in Alteryx offers a powerful tool for comparing columns and performing conditional formatting. Whether it is for data validation, outlier detection, trend analysis, or performance evaluation, the Multi Field formula enables users to gain deeper insights into their data. With its flexibility and versatility, this feature proves to be essential for data analysts and professionals in their data analysis workflows.

Setting Up Conditional Formatting

Step-by-step guide on how to set up conditional formatting in your view

To set up conditional formatting in your PivotTable report, follow these steps:

1. Select the range of cells, the table, or the whole sheet that you want to apply conditional formatting to.

2. On the Home tab, click on Conditional Formatting.

3. Click on New Rule.

4. Select a style, for example, 3-Color Scale.

5. Select the conditions that you want to apply using the drop-down menus and input boxes.

6. Click OK to apply the conditional formatting to your selected range or table.

7. Repeat these steps for each field that you want to apply conditional formatting to.

Choosing the fields to compare and defining the criteria

When setting up conditional formatting in a PivotTable report, you have the option to choose fields to compare and define the criteria for formatting. Here’s how to do it:

1. Click on the Formatting Options button that appears next to a PivotTable field that has conditional formatting applied.

2. In the Conditional Formatting Rules Manager dialog box, you can manage existing rules, add new rules, and duplicate rules.

3. To add a completely new conditional format, click on New Rule. You can select from various formatting options such as Highlight Cells Rules, Top/Bottom Rules, Data Bars, Color Scales, and Icon Sets.

4. To add a new conditional format based on one that is already listed, select the rule and click on Duplicate Rule.

5. In the selected formatting option, you can choose the command you want, such as Between, Equal To, Text that Contains, or A Date Occurring. Enter the values you want to use and then select a format.

6. If you’d like to watch videos on these techniques, you can visit the specified links.

By following these steps, you can customize the conditional formatting in your PivotTable report and highlight the necessary data based on your defined criteria. This feature allows you to easily identify trends, patterns, and outliers in your data, making data analysis more efficient and effective.

Understanding the Code

Now that we have seen how to set up conditional formatting in Excel, let’s take a closer look at the code snippet provided. This will help us understand how the fields are compared and how the criteria for formatting are defined.

Explaining the code syntax for comparing fields in conditional formatting

The code snippet compares the fields of two objects to determine whether they are equal. Here are the steps involved in the comparison:

1. Select the range of cells, table, or sheet to which you want to apply conditional formatting.

2. Use the Conditional Formatting option in the Home tab to specify the formatting rules.

3. Choose a style for the formatting, such as 3-Color Scale.

4. Define the conditions for applying the formatting by using the drop-down menus and input boxes.

5. Click OK to apply the conditional formatting to the selected range or table.

By following these steps, you can customize the conditional formatting in your PivotTable report based on your desired criteria.

Detailed breakdown of the different elements in the code

Let’s examine the code snippet in more detail to understand its functionality:

1. The equals() method is overridden to compare the fields of two objects.

2. The method takes an Object parameter, which is the object being compared to the current instance.

3. The method checks whether the instance being compared (this) is the same as the object passed as the parameter (obj). If they are the same, it returns true; otherwise, it returns false.

4. When the equals() method is not overridden, the default implementation in the Object class is invoked, which compares the memory addresses of the objects. This is not what we want in most cases, as we usually want to compare the actual content of the objects.

By understanding how the code works and how the fields are compared, we can make better use of the conditional formatting feature in Excel and create more insightful reports.

In conclusion, conditional formatting is a powerful tool in Excel that allows you to highlight specific data based on predefined criteria. By understanding the code behind the feature, you can customize the formatting rules and achieve more meaningful and visually appealing reports. Whether you are analyzing data trends, identifying patterns, or highlighting outliers, conditional formatting can greatly enhance your data analysis capabilities.

Comparing Standard Fields

Comparison of standard fields in conditional formatting

Conditional formatting in a view allows you to compare two different fields and highlight them based on specific criteria. This feature is useful for identifying patterns, trends, and outliers in your data. Here are some examples of how you can compare different standard fields using conditional formatting:

– Date fields: You can compare two date fields and highlight them when they are equal or when one date is before or after the other. For example, you can highlight a date field when it matches the current date or when it is within a certain number of days from another date.

– Text fields: Conditional formatting can also be used to compare two text fields. You can highlight them when they are equal, when one text contains specific words or phrases, or when they start or end with a certain text. This is helpful for identifying duplicate or unique values in your data.

– Number fields: If you have two number fields, you can use conditional formatting to compare them based on mathematical operations. For example, you can highlight a number field when it is greater than, less than, equal to, or falls within a specific range compared to another number field.

By utilizing conditional formatting to compare different standard fields, you can easily spot any discrepancies or similarities between the fields and make data-driven decisions accordingly.

Examples of comparing fields such as date, text, and number

Let’s take a look at some practical examples of comparing fields using conditional formatting:

– Date example: Suppose you have two date fields, “Start Date” and “End Date.” You can set up conditional formatting to highlight the “End Date” field in red when it is before the “Start Date” field, indicating an incorrect date range.

– Text example: Imagine you have two text fields, “Product Name” and “Category.” You can use conditional formatting to highlight the “Product Name” field when the corresponding “Category” field contains the word “Out of Stock,” indicating that the product is currently unavailable.

– Number example: If you have two number fields, “Revenue” and “Target Revenue,” you can apply conditional formatting to highlight the “Revenue” field in green when it exceeds the “Target Revenue” field, indicating that the revenue goal has been achieved.

These examples demonstrate how conditional formatting can be applied to different fields and help you quickly identify important information in your data.

By leveraging the power of conditional formatting, you can efficiently analyze and interpret your data, enabling better decision-making and improving overall data management.

Remember to always set up clear criteria and formatting styles when comparing fields in conditional formatting to ensure accurate and meaningful visualizations of your data.

In conclusion, conditional formatting provides a powerful tool for comparing fields in a view and highlighting them based on specific criteria. This feature allows you to easily identify patterns, trends, and outliers in your data, enhancing data analysis and decision-making. Whether you are comparing date fields, text fields, or number fields, conditional formatting can be customized to meet your specific needs. Start exploring the possibilities of conditional formatting in your views and unlock valuable insights hidden within your data.

Comparing Custom Fields

Comparison of custom fields in conditional formatting

Conditional formatting in a view not only allows you to compare standard fields but also gives you the flexibility to compare custom fields. This enables you to apply conditional formatting based on specific criteria and highlight the custom fields when certain conditions are met. Here are some examples of how you can compare different custom fields using conditional formatting:

– Custom date fields: You can compare two custom date fields and highlight them when they are equal or when one date is before or after the other. For instance, you can highlight a custom date field when it matches the project deadline or when it falls within a certain number of days from another custom date field.

– Custom text fields: Conditional formatting can be used to compare two custom text fields as well. You can highlight them when they are equal, when one text contains specific words or phrases, or when they start or end with a particular text. This can be useful for identifying discrepancies or patterns in your custom text fields.

– Custom number fields: Similar to custom date and text fields, you can also compare two custom number fields using conditional formatting. You can highlight them when they meet certain mathematical conditions, such as being greater than, less than, equal to, or within a specific range compared to another custom number field.

Instructions on how to reference custom fields in the code

When comparing custom fields in conditional formatting, it is important to reference them correctly in the code. Here’s an example:

Suppose you have a custom field labeled “Delivery Date” and you want to compare it with another custom field. To do this, you need to use the correct name for the custom field in the code.

In your text mode code, you would add the following statement to compare the custom field labeled “Delivery Date”:

styledef.case.comparison.rightmethod=DE:Delivery Date

Make sure that the “righttext” line of code matches the statement in the “rightmethod” line of code. This ensures that the conditional formatting properly compares the custom fields and applies the desired formatting based on the criteria you set.

By following these instructions and referencing the custom fields accurately in the code, you can effectively compare and highlight custom fields using conditional formatting.

In conclusion, conditional formatting offers a powerful feature for comparing custom fields in a view and applying formatting based on specific criteria. Whether you are dealing with custom date fields, text fields, or number fields, conditional formatting can be customized to meet your unique requirements. By leveraging this functionality, you can easily identify patterns, inconsistencies, and important insights in your data, leading to informed decision-making and improved data management. Take advantage of conditional formatting in your views to unlock the full potential of your custom fields and enhance your data analysis capabilities.

Advanced Conditional Formatting Techniques

Advanced techniques for comparing fields in conditional formatting

Conditional formatting is a powerful feature that allows you to compare fields in a view and highlight them based on specific criteria. While the basic techniques are useful, there are advanced techniques that can further enhance your data analysis and visualization. Here are some advanced techniques you can use for comparing fields in conditional formatting:

– Using logical operators: In addition to basic comparisons, you can use logical operators such as AND, OR, and NOT to create more complex conditions. For example, you can highlight a field when it meets multiple criteria simultaneously using the AND operator, or when it meets at least one of several criteria using the OR operator.

– Using expressions: Expressions allow you to perform calculations or manipulate field values before comparing them. You can use expressions to extract specific parts of a field value, convert data types, or perform mathematical operations. This provides more flexibility in defining your comparison criteria.

– Using functions: Functions are predefined formulas that perform specific operations on field values. You can use functions to perform advanced calculations, manipulate text, extract substrings, or evaluate logical conditions. Functions can help you create more complex and dynamic conditional formatting rules.

Examples of advanced techniques

Let’s explore some examples of advanced techniques for comparing fields in conditional formatting:

– Logical operators example: Suppose you have three fields, “Unit Price,” “Quantity,” and “Discount.” You can use the AND operator to highlight the “Total Price” field when the unit price is greater than a certain value AND the quantity is above a certain threshold. This allows you to identify high-value items that are selling well.

– Expressions example: Imagine you have a field called “Product Code” that contains alphanumeric codes. You can use an expression to extract the first letter of the code and compare it to a predefined list of valid letters. This can help you identify invalid or typo-filled product codes.

– Functions example: If you have a field called “Order Date,” you can use the DATE function to extract the month from the date and compare it to the current month. This allows you to highlight orders that were placed in the current month and track monthly trends in your data.

By using these advanced techniques, you can create more sophisticated and customized conditional formatting rules that meet your specific requirements. These techniques enable you to perform complex comparisons, calculations, and manipulations on field values, resulting in more accurate and meaningful visualizations of your data.

In conclusion, conditional formatting provides a powerful tool for comparing fields in a view and highlighting them based on specific criteria. By using advanced techniques such as logical operators, expressions, and functions, you can further enhance your data analysis and visualization. These techniques allow you to create more complex conditional formatting rules that accommodate a wide range of comparison scenarios. Start exploring the advanced capabilities of conditional formatting and unlock deeper insights in your data.

Testing and Troubleshooting

Tips for testing and troubleshooting your conditional formatting rules

When working with conditional formatting, it is important to thoroughly test and troubleshoot your rules to ensure that they are working correctly. Here are some tips to help you in the testing and troubleshooting process:

– Test with different scenarios: To ensure that your conditional formatting rules are robust, test them with different data scenarios. This includes testing with different data values, data types, and variations in the data. By testing with various scenarios, you can identify any issues or unexpected behaviors in your rules.

– Use sample data: Create a sample dataset that represents real-world data. This will allow you to simulate the actual data that your rules will be applied to. By using sample data, you can verify if your rules are correctly highlighting the desired fields based on the defined criteria.

– Start with simple rules: When starting with conditional formatting, it is recommended to begin with simple rules and gradually increase the complexity. By starting simple, you can easily identify any issues or errors in your rules and fix them before adding more complexity.

– Test on different devices and browsers: Ensure that you test your conditional formatting rules on different devices and browsers. This is important because different browsers and devices may interpret the rules differently, leading to inconsistent results. By testing on various platforms, you can ensure that your rules function correctly across different environments.

Common issues and solutions

While testing and troubleshooting, you may come across some common issues with your conditional formatting rules. Here are some common issues and their solutions:

– Incorrect formula or criteria: One of the main reasons for conditional formatting issues is an incorrect formula or criteria definition. Double-check your formulas and make sure that they accurately represent the conditions for highlighting. Also, ensure that you are using the correct operators and functions in your formulas.

– Overlapping rules: When you have multiple formatting rules applied to the same cells or fields, they can conflict with each other and produce unexpected results. Make sure to prioritize your rules and organize them in a way that avoids overlapping or conflicting conditions.

– Performance issues: Sometimes, when you have complex conditional formatting rules or a large dataset, the performance of your spreadsheet or application may be affected. To address this, consider optimizing your rules by simplifying complex formulas or limiting the range of cells or fields affected by the rules.

– Compatibility issues: Conditional formatting may not be supported in older versions of software or in certain file formats. If you encounter compatibility issues, consider using alternative methods or workarounds to achieve the desired highlighting effects.

By following these tips and addressing the common issues, you can ensure that your conditional formatting rules are effective and reliable. Testing and troubleshooting play a crucial role in maintaining the accuracy and functionality of your rules, ultimately improving the quality of your data analysis and visualization.

Best Practices and Recommendations

Best practices for comparing fields in conditional formatting

When comparing fields in conditional formatting, there are some best practices to keep in mind to ensure accurate and efficient results:

– Use clear and descriptive criteria: Clearly define the criteria for comparing fields and highlight them in your conditional formatting rule. This will make it easier for others to understand your formatting logic and update the rule if needed.

– Test your rule on sample data: Before applying your conditional formatting rule to a large dataset, test it on a small sample of data. This will help you verify that the rule is working as expected and identify any potential issues or errors.

– Regularly review and update your rules: As your data changes over time, it’s important to review and update your conditional formatting rules accordingly. This will ensure that the formatting remains relevant and accurate.

– Document your conditional formatting rules: Documenting your conditional formatting rules is essential for future reference and collaboration. Include information about the fields being compared, the criteria used, and any specific considerations or limitations.

Recommendations for optimizing the performance of your conditional formatting rules

To optimize the performance of your conditional formatting rules, consider the following recommendations:

– Limit the number of rules: Having too many conditional formatting rules can slow down the performance of your spreadsheet or application. Whenever possible, try to consolidate rules or find alternative ways to achieve the desired formatting.

– Use cell references instead of specific values: Instead of hardcoding specific values in your conditional formatting rules, use cell references. This allows you to easily update the values without changing the formatting rules themselves.

– Use the “Stop If True” option: In some cases, you may have multiple conditional formatting rules applied to the same range of cells. By enabling the “Stop If True” option for each rule, you can improve performance by preventing unnecessary evaluations once a condition is met.

– Consider the order of your rules: The order in which you set up your conditional formatting rules can impact their performance. Try to prioritize rules that are likely to evaluate to true more frequently, as this can reduce the number of evaluations needed.

– Use ranges instead of individual cells: Instead of applying conditional formatting to individual cells, consider applying it to entire ranges or columns. This can improve performance by reducing the number of formatting calculations required.

By following these best practices and recommendations, you can effectively compare fields in conditional formatting and optimize the performance of your rules. Remember to regularly review and update your rules as your data changes, and document your formatting logic for future reference and collaboration.

Conclusion

Summary of the benefits and uses of comparing fields in conditional formatting

Comparing fields in conditional formatting allows users to highlight specific data points in a view based on certain criteria. This feature provides several benefits, including:

1. Improved data analysis: By comparing different fields, users can easily identify patterns or anomalies in their data. This can lead to more informed decision making and a better understanding of the data at hand.

2. Enhanced data visualization: Conditional formatting enables users to visually represent the comparison results, making it easier to interpret and analyze the data. By highlighting certain fields, users can quickly focus on specific data points that require attention.

3. Increased data accuracy: By applying conditional formatting rules, users can ensure that data inconsistencies or errors are easily identified. This helps maintain data integrity and improves overall data quality.

Some common use cases for comparing fields in conditional formatting include:

– Identifying overdue tasks or milestones in project management software

– Highlighting discrepancies in inventory levels or sales data

– Flagging outliers or unusual data points in financial analysis

Final thoughts and considerations for implementing this feature in your workflows

When implementing comparing fields in conditional formatting in your workflows, consider the following points:

1. Understand your data: Before applying conditional formatting rules, make sure you have a clear understanding of the data you are working with. This will help you define the appropriate criteria for comparison and ensure accurate results.

2. Prioritize performance: While conditional formatting is a powerful tool, using too many formatting rules or complex formulas can slow down the performance of your spreadsheet or application. Make sure to optimize your rules and consider alternative approaches when necessary.

3. Document your rules: As with any data manipulation feature, it’s important to document your conditional formatting rules. This will make it easier for other users to understand and maintain the rules, as well as troubleshoot any issues that may arise.

4. Regularly review and update rules: Data can change over time, so it’s important to regularly review and update your conditional formatting rules. This will ensure that the formatting remains relevant and effective as your data evolves.

In conclusion, comparing fields in conditional formatting is a valuable feature that allows users to highlight and analyze data based on specific criteria. By following best practices and considering important considerations, users can effectively implement this feature in their workflows and make data-driven decisions.

About The Author

Leave a Reply

Your email address will not be published. Required fields are marked *

Index